本地搭建微信小程序的全面指南
一、准备工作:打造坚实的开发基石
在踏上本地搭建微信小程序的征途前,我们需要做好充分的准备工作。这包括但不限于: 注册开发者账号:首先,您需要在微信公众平台上注册一个小程序账号,并完成相关认证。 安装开发工具:微信官方提供了小程序开发者工具,这是进行本地开发不可或缺的工具。请从微信官方网站下载并安装。 配置开发环境:确保您的电脑安装了Node.js和npm(Node Package Manager),这是构建小程序项目的基础。二、项目初始化:迈出开发的第一步
完成准备工作后,接下来是项目的初始化阶段。 登录开发者工具 使用您的小程序账号登录微信开发者工具。 创建新项目:在开发者工具中,点击“创建新项目”,按照提示填写项目名称、目录、AppID等信息。AppID可以在您的小程序账号后台找到。 配置项目信息:根据项目需求,配置项目的基本信息,如页面路径、窗口表现等。三、编码实践:构建小程序的核心功能
项目初始化完成后,接下来是编码实践阶段。在这一阶段,您将深入小程序的各个组成部分,实现核心功能。
页面结构搭建:使用WXML(WeiXin Markup Language)搭建页面的基本结构。WXML类似于HTML,但具有一些微信特有的标签和属性。
样式设计:通过WXSS(WeiXin Style Sheets)为页面添加样式。WXSS类似于CSS,但提供了一些针对小程序的优化特性。
逻辑处理:使用JavaScript编写页面的逻辑处理代码。在小程序中,每个页面都有一个对应的JS文件,用于处理页面事件和数据绑定。
API调用:利用微信小程序提供的丰富API,实现各种功能,如用户授权、支付、云函数等。
四、科技助力:提升开发效率与质量
作为专业的技术服务商,科技在小程序开发领域积累了丰富的经验。我们不仅可以为您提供定制化的开发服务,还可以分享一些提升开发效率与质量的实用技巧: 模块化开发:将功能相似的代码封装成模块,提高代码的可维护性和复用性。 组件化思想:利用小程序提供的组件化特性,将页面中的重复元素封装成组件,简化页面结构。 持续集成/持续部署(CI/CD) 引入CI/CD流程,自动化构建、测试和部署项目,提高开发效率。 性能优化:关注小程序的性能瓶颈,如网络请求、页面渲染等,进行有针对性的优化。五、测试与调试:确保应用稳定运行
在开发过程中,测试和调试是不可或缺的一环。通过微信开发者工具提供的测试功能,您可以对小程序进行全面的测试: 功能测试:验证小程序的各项功能是否按预期工作。 兼容性测试 在不同设备和操作系统上测试小程序,确保其在各种环境下的兼容性。 性能测试:关注小程序的启动速度、页面加载时间等性能指标,进行必要的优化。 调试工具:利用开发者工具提供的调试功能,定位并解决代码中的错误。六、部署与发布:将成果推向市场
经过测试与调试后,小程序已经准备就绪,接下来是部署与发布阶段。
上传代码:在开发者工具中,点击“上传”按钮,将代码上传至微信服务器。
提交审核:在微信小程序后台,提交代码进行审核。审核通过后,您将获得发布权限。
发布上线:审核通过后,您可以点击“发布”按钮,将小程序发布上线。
至此,您已经成功完成了本地搭建微信小程序的全部流程。科技愿与您携手共进,共同探索小程序开发的无限可能。
TAG标签: 微信小程序开发微信小程序定制开发微信小程序开发公司抖音小程序开发百度小程序开发支付宝小程序开发微信公众号开发微信社交电商分销系统
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。
